Job Title: Senior HR Advisor
Salary: £45,000-50,000
Bonus: up to 15% annual salary
Annual leave : 25 days plus bank holidays
Hours of work: Monday to Friday, 37.5 hours, some flexibility required to support night shift as and when required.
Flexi time: core hours 09:30 to 14:30, with the ability to accrue an additional day leave per quarter
Location: Blackburn, North West England
Reporting to: HR Business Partner
Role PurposeThe Senior HR Advisor (SHRA) will play a pivotal role in delivering high-quality, pragmatic HR support within a fast-paced manufacturing environment. With strong expertise in employee relations and a growing capability in HR data analytics , this role supports leaders to make informed, fair, and commercially sound people decisions. By strategically leveraging core corporate HR resources talent, capability, culture, and data the SHRA will directly impact growth, and operational scalability.
This position is ideal for an experienced HR professional who thrives in operational HR while actively developing the skills and exposure required to progress into an HR Business Partner role in the future.
Key Responsibilities Employee Relations- Lead and manage a wide range of employee relations cases, including disciplinary, grievance, absence management, performance management and complex investigations
- Provide confident, balanced and legally compliant advice to line managers on UK employment law and internal policies
- Coach and upskill managers to build capability and confidence in managing people issues effectively
- Support change initiatives such as restructures, organisational change and consultations within a manufacturing setting
- Build trusted relationships with employees, managers and union or employee representatives (where applicable)
- Analyse HR data (e.g. absence, turnover, ER trends, engagement metrics) to identify risks, trends and improvement opportunities
- Produce insightful reports and dashboards to inform leadership decision-making
- Use data to support workforce planning, improve ER outcomes and enhance employee engagement
- Ensure data accuracy and compliance with GDPR and internal data governance standards
- Act as a senior point of contact for HR queries across the site(s)
- Support the delivery of HR cycles such as performance reviews, engagement surveys and policy updates
- Contribute to the continuous improvement of HR processes, policies and ways of working
- Collaborate closely with HR Business Partners, Payroll, Learning & Development and Recruitment teams

Essential:
- Proven experience in a Senior HR Advisor or equivalent role, ideally within manufacturing or a similar operational environment
- Strong, hands on experience managing complex employee relations cases independently
- Sound knowledge of UK employment law and HR best practice
- Experience using HR data and metrics to provide insight and influence outcomes
- Confident communicator with the ability to challenge constructively and build trust
- CIPD Level 5 qualified (or equivalent experience)
Desirable:
- CIPD Level 7 (or working towards)
- Experience supporting organisational change or transformation
- Experience of working within a US Corporation
